I've never had a sustained period of medication for mental illness when I've not been on other drugs as well. It's just not something that I particularly feel I need. I know that I have dramatically changing moods, and I know sometimes I feel really depressed, but I think that's just life. I don't think of it as, "Ah, this is mental illness," more as, "Today, life makes me feel very sad." I know I also get unnaturally high levels of energy and quickness of thought, but I'm able to utilize that.
Russell Brand

Interpretation

What this quote means

The quote reflects on the author's acceptance of fluctuating emotions, viewing them as a normal part of life rather than a mental illness.

In this quote, Russell Brand discusses his experiences with mental health and the way he perceives his mood swings. Rather than labeling his emotional highs and lows as mental illness, he interprets them as natural changes that come with life. This perspective emphasizes acceptance and understanding of one's emotional state, suggesting that instead of seeking to categorize these feelings strictly within the confines of mental health conditions, it can be more beneficial to recognize them as part of the human experience.
